Capacitors store and release electrical energy, helping to filter out noise, stabilize voltage, and store charges. When it comes to choosing the right capacitor value, there are a few key factors to consider.<\/p>\n<p>First and foremost, you need to determine the purpose of the capacitor in your circuit. Do you need it for filtering, decoupling, timing, or energy storage? The capacitor&#8217;s value will depend on its specific function within the circuit.<\/p>\n<p>Secondly, consider the frequency of the AC signal in your circuit. Capacitors have impedance that varies depending on the frequency of the signal passing through them. For low-frequency applications, larger capacitor values are typically used, while for high-frequency applications, smaller capacitor values are preferred.<\/p>\n<p>Additionally, take into account the voltage requirements of your circuit. Make sure the capacitor&#8217;s voltage rating is higher than the maximum voltage in your circuit to prevent damage or failure.<\/p>\n<p>Lastly, think about the physical size and cost constraints of your project. Larger capacitors tend to have higher capacitance values but can take up more space and be more expensive. Balance the size, cost, and performance requirements to find the optimal capacitor value for your circuit.<\/p>\n<h3><span class=\"ez-toc-section\" id=\"FAQs_on_selecting_capacitor_value\"><\/span>FAQs on selecting capacitor value:<span class=\"ez-toc-section-end\"><\/span><\/h3>\n<h3><span class=\"ez-toc-section\" id=\"1_How_does_capacitance_affect_the_performance_of_a_capacitor\"><\/span>1. How does capacitance affect the performance of a capacitor?<span class=\"ez-toc-section-end\"><\/span><\/h3>\n<p>\nCapacitance determines the amount of charge a capacitor can store for a given voltage. Higher capacitance values result in a greater ability to store charges and filter out noise.<\/p>\n<h3><span class=\"ez-toc-section\" id=\"2_What_is_the_relationship_between_capacitor_value_and_frequency\"><\/span>2. What is the relationship between capacitor value and frequency?<span class=\"ez-toc-section-end\"><\/span><\/h3>\n<p>\nCapacitor impedance decreases as frequency increases. Therefore, for high-frequency applications, smaller capacitor values are preferred.<\/p>\n<h3><span class=\"ez-toc-section\" id=\"3_Can_I_use_a_capacitor_with_a_lower_voltage_rating_than_the_maximum_voltage_in_my_circuit\"><\/span>3. Can I use a capacitor with a lower voltage rating than the maximum voltage in my circuit?<span class=\"ez-toc-section-end\"><\/span><\/h3>\n<p>\nIt&#8217;s not recommended to use a capacitor with a lower voltage rating than the maximum voltage in your circuit, as it can lead to failure or damage.<\/p>\n<h3><span class=\"ez-toc-section\" id=\"4_How_does_the_physical_size_of_a_capacitor_relate_to_its_capacitance_value\"><\/span>4. How does the physical size of a capacitor relate to its capacitance value?<span class=\"ez-toc-section-end\"><\/span><\/h3>\n<p>\nIn general, larger capacitors have higher capacitance values. However, they also take up more space and can be more expensive.<\/p>\n<h3><span class=\"ez-toc-section\" id=\"5_What_are_some_common_capacitor_values_used_in_electronic_circuits\"><\/span>5. What are some common capacitor values used in electronic circuits?<span class=\"ez-toc-section-end\"><\/span><\/h3>\n<p>\nCommon capacitor values include picofarads (pF), nanofarads (nF), and microfarads (uF). The specific value you choose depends on the requirements of your circuit.<\/p>\n<h3><span class=\"ez-toc-section\" id=\"6_How_does_temperature_affect_the_performance_of_a_capacitor\"><\/span>6. How does temperature affect the performance of a capacitor?<span class=\"ez-toc-section-end\"><\/span><\/h3>\n<p>\nCapacitors can be sensitive to temperature changes, with capacitance values varying with temperature. Choose capacitors with stable temperature coefficients for consistent performance.<\/p>\n<h3><span class=\"ez-toc-section\" id=\"7_Can_I_stack_capacitors_to_achieve_a_desired_capacitance_value\"><\/span>7. Can I stack capacitors to achieve a desired capacitance value?<span class=\"ez-toc-section-end\"><\/span><\/h3>\n<p>\nYes, you can stack capacitors in parallel to increase the total capacitance value. Be cautious of voltage ratings and ensure proper connections to avoid damage.<\/p>\n<h3><span class=\"ez-toc-section\" id=\"8_Is_it_better_to_use_multiple_capacitors_in_parallel_or_a_single_capacitor_with_the_desired_value\"><\/span>8. Is it better to use multiple capacitors in parallel or a single capacitor with the desired value?<span class=\"ez-toc-section-end\"><\/span><\/h3>\n<p>\nUsing multiple capacitors in parallel can provide flexibility in adjusting capacitance values and distributing current loads. However, a single capacitor with the desired value may offer better performance in some cases.<\/p>\n<h3><span class=\"ez-toc-section\" id=\"9_What_role_does_ESR_Equivalent_Series_Resistance_play_in_capacitor_selection\"><\/span>9. What role does ESR (Equivalent Series Resistance) play in capacitor selection?<span class=\"ez-toc-section-end\"><\/span><\/h3>\n<p>\nESR affects the efficiency and performance of capacitors. Choose capacitors with low ESR values for better filtering and energy storage capabilities.<\/p>\n<h3><span class=\"ez-toc-section\" id=\"10_How_can_I_calculate_the_capacitance_value_needed_for_my_circuit\"><\/span>10. How can I calculate the capacitance value needed for my circuit?<span class=\"ez-toc-section-end\"><\/span><\/h3>\n<p>\nUse the formula C = Q\/V, where C is capacitance, Q is charge in coulombs, and V is voltage. Determine the amount of charge needed and the voltage range in your circuit to calculate the required capacitance value.<\/p>\n<h3><span class=\"ez-toc-section\" id=\"11_Are_there_specific_capacitor_technologies_that_should_be_considered_when_choosing_capacitor_value\"><\/span>11. Are there specific capacitor technologies that should be considered when choosing capacitor value?<span class=\"ez-toc-section-end\"><\/span><\/h3>\n<p>\nDifferent capacitor technologies, such as ceramic, electrolytic, and tantalum, offer different performance characteristics. Consider the voltage rating, temperature stability, and ESR of each technology when selecting the capacitor value.<\/p>\n<h3><span class=\"ez-toc-section\" id=\"12_How_can_I_test_and_evaluate_the_performance_of_a_chosen_capacitor_value_in_my_circuit\"><\/span>12. How can I test and evaluate the performance of a chosen capacitor value in my circuit?<span class=\"ez-toc-section-end\"><\/span><\/h3>\n<p>\nUse an oscilloscope or multimeter to measure the capacitor&#8217;s voltage, current, and impedance in the circuit. Evaluate the performance based on the desired functionality and adjust the capacitor value if necessary to optimize circuit performance.<\/p>\n","protected":false},"excerpt":{"rendered":"<p>How to choose capacitor value?
